Skip to content

Commit

Permalink
Update dependencies (#1204)
Browse files Browse the repository at this point in the history
* Update equalsverifier

* Update groovy

* Update license-maven-plugin

* Update h2

* Update Trino

* Add H2 tests
  • Loading branch information
sualeh committed Jul 8, 2023
1 parent e4a04c3 commit d8baf1a
Show file tree
Hide file tree
Showing 9 changed files with 55 additions and 55 deletions.
Expand Up @@ -65,7 +65,7 @@ public class TrinoTest extends BaseAdditionalDatabaseTest {
private final DockerImageName imageName = DockerImageName.parse("trinodb/trino");

@Container
private final JdbcDatabaseContainer<?> dbContainer = new TrinoContainer(imageName.withTag("419"));
private final JdbcDatabaseContainer<?> dbContainer = new TrinoContainer(imageName.withTag("421"));

@BeforeEach
public void createDatabase() {
Expand Down
36 changes: 18 additions & 18 deletions schemacrawler-dbtest/src/test/resources/testH2WithConnection.8.txt
Expand Up @@ -3,10 +3,10 @@
System Information
========================================================================

generated by SchemaCrawler 16.19.7
generated on 2023-02-28 22:14:43
database version H2 2.1.214 (2022-06-13)
driver version H2 JDBC Driver 2.1.214 (2022-06-13)
generated by SchemaCrawler 16.20.2
generated on 2023-07-08 21:06:17
database version H2 2.2.220 (2023-07-04)
driver version H2 JDBC Driver 2.2.220 (2023-07-04)



Expand Down Expand Up @@ -344,7 +344,7 @@ ARRAY [data type]
BIGINT [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

BINARY [data type]
Expand Down Expand Up @@ -398,13 +398,13 @@ DATE [data type]
DECFLOAT [data type]
defined with PRECISION
nullable
not auto-incrementable
auto-incrementable
searchable

DOUBLE PRECISION [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

ENUM [data type]
Expand All @@ -422,7 +422,7 @@ GEOMETRY [data type]
INTEGER [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

INTERVAL DAY [data type]
Expand Down Expand Up @@ -518,13 +518,13 @@ JSON [data type]
NUMERIC [data type]
defined with PRECISION,SCALE
nullable
not auto-incrementable
auto-incrementable
searchable

REAL [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

ROW [data type]
Expand All @@ -536,7 +536,7 @@ ROW [data type]
SMALLINT [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

TIME [data type]
Expand Down Expand Up @@ -566,7 +566,7 @@ TIME WITH TIME ZONE [data type]
TINYINT [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

UUID [data type]
Expand Down Expand Up @@ -604,7 +604,7 @@ System Information
Database Information
-=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=-
database product name H2
database product version 2.1.214 (2022-06-13)
database product version 2.2.220 (2023-07-04)
database user name


Expand All @@ -620,14 +620,14 @@ client info properties numServers
data definition causes transaction commit true
data definition ignored in transactions false
database major version 2
database minor version 1
database minor version 2
default transaction isolation 2
deletes are detected for TYPE_FORWARD_ONLY result sets false
deletes are detected for TYPE_SCROLL_INSENSITIVE result sets false
deletes are detected for TYPE_SCROLL_SENSITIVE result sets false
does max row size include blobs false
driver major version 2
driver minor version 1
driver minor version 2
extra name characters
generated key always returned true
identifier quote string "
Expand Down Expand Up @@ -698,7 +698,7 @@ stores mixed case identifiers false
stores mixed case quoted identifiers false
stores upper case identifiers true
stores upper case quoted identifiers false
string functions ASCII, BIT_LENGTH, CHAR_LENGTH, OCTET_LENGTH, CHAR, CONCAT, CONCAT_WS, DIFFERENCE, HEXTORAW, RAWTOHEX, INSERT, LOWER, UPPER, LEFT, RIGHT, LOCATE, LPAD, RPAD, LTRIM, RTRIM, TRIM, REGEXP_REPLACE, REGEXP_LIKE, REGEXP_SUBSTR, REPEAT, REPLACE, SOUNDEX, SPACE, STRINGDECODE, STRINGENCODE, STRINGTOUTF8, SUBSTRING, UTF8TOSTRING, QUOTE_IDENT, XMLATTR, XMLNODE, XMLCOMMENT, XMLCDATA, XMLSTARTDOC, XMLTEXT, TO_CHAR, TRANSLATE
string functions ASCII, BIT_LENGTH, CHAR_LENGTH, OCTET_LENGTH, CHAR, CONCAT, CONCAT_WS, DIFFERENCE, HEXTORAW, RAWTOHEX, INSERT, LOWER, UPPER, LEFT, RIGHT, LOCATE, LPAD, RPAD, LTRIM, RTRIM, BTRIM, TRIM, REGEXP_REPLACE, REGEXP_LIKE, REGEXP_SUBSTR, REPEAT, REPLACE, SOUNDEX, SPACE, STRINGDECODE, STRINGENCODE, STRINGTOUTF8, SUBSTRING, UTF8TOSTRING, QUOTE_IDENT, XMLATTR, XMLNODE, XMLCOMMENT, XMLCDATA, XMLSTARTDOC, XMLTEXT, TO_CHAR, TRANSLATE
supports alter table with add column true
supports alter table with drop column true
supports ANSI92 entry level SQL true
Expand Down Expand Up @@ -767,7 +767,7 @@ supports union true
supports union all true
system functions ABORT_SESSION, ARRAY_GET, CARDINALITY, ARRAY_CONTAINS, ARRAY_CAT, ARRAY_APPEND, ARRAY_MAX_CARDINALITY, TRIM_ARRAY, ARRAY_SLICE, AUTOCOMMIT, CANCEL_SESSION, CASEWHEN, COALESCE, CONVERT, CURRVAL, CSVWRITE, CURRENT_SCHEMA, CURRENT_CATALOG, DATABASE_PATH, DATA_TYPE_SQL, DB_OBJECT_ID, DB_OBJECT_SQL, DECODE, DISK_SPACE_USED, SIGNAL, ESTIMATED_ENVELOPE, FILE_READ, FILE_WRITE, GREATEST, LEAST, LOCK_MODE, LOCK_TIMEOUT, MEMORY_FREE, MEMORY_USED, NEXTVAL, NULLIF, NVL2, READONLY, ROWNUM, SESSION_ID, SET, TRANSACTION_ID, TRUNCATE_VALUE, CURRENT_PATH, CURRENT_ROLE, CURRENT_USER, H2VERSION
table types BASE TABLE, GLOBAL TEMPORARY, LOCAL TEMPORARY, SYNONYM, VIEW
time date functions CURRENT_DATE, CURRENT_TIME, CURRENT_TIMESTAMP, LOCALTIME, LOCALTIMESTAMP, DATEADD, DATEDIFF, DATE_TRUNC, DAYNAME, DAY_OF_MONTH, DAY_OF_WEEK, ISO_DAY_OF_WEEK, DAY_OF_YEAR, EXTRACT, FORMATDATETIME, HOUR, MINUTE, MONTH, MONTHNAME, PARSEDATETIME, QUARTER, SECOND, WEEK, ISO_WEEK, YEAR, ISO_YEAR
time date functions CURRENT_DATE, CURRENT_TIME, CURRENT_TIMESTAMP, LOCALTIME, LOCALTIMESTAMP, DATEADD, DATEDIFF, DATE_TRUNC, LAST_DAY, DAYNAME, DAY_OF_MONTH, DAY_OF_WEEK, ISO_DAY_OF_WEEK, DAY_OF_YEAR, EXTRACT, FORMATDATETIME, HOUR, MINUTE, MONTH, MONTHNAME, PARSEDATETIME, QUARTER, SECOND, WEEK, ISO_WEEK, YEAR, ISO_YEAR
type info ARRAY, BIGINT, BINARY, BINARY LARGE OBJECT, BINARY VARYING, BOOLEAN, CHARACTER, CHARACTER LARGE OBJECT, CHARACTER VARYING, DATE, DECFLOAT, DOUBLE PRECISION, ENUM, GEOMETRY, INTEGER, INTERVAL DAY, INTERVAL DAY TO HOUR, INTERVAL DAY TO MINUTE, INTERVAL DAY TO SECOND, INTERVAL HOUR, INTERVAL HOUR TO MINUTE, INTERVAL HOUR TO SECOND, INTERVAL MINUTE, INTERVAL MINUTE TO SECOND, INTERVAL MONTH, INTERVAL SECOND, INTERVAL YEAR, INTERVAL YEAR TO MONTH, JAVA_OBJECT, JSON, NUMERIC, REAL, ROW, SMALLINT, TIME, TIME WITH TIME ZONE, TIMESTAMP, TIMESTAMP WITH TIME ZONE, TINYINT, UUID, VARCHAR_IGNORECASE
updates are detected for TYPE_FORWARD_ONLY result sets false
updates are detected for TYPE_SCROLL_INSENSITIVE result sets false
Expand All @@ -780,7 +780,7 @@ JDBC Driver Information
-=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=-
connection url jdbc:h2:mem:schemacrawler
driver name H2 JDBC Driver
driver version 2.1.214 (2022-06-13)
driver version 2.2.220 (2023-07-04)
driver class name org.h2.Driver
is JDBC compliant true
supported JDBC version 4.2
Expand Down
Expand Up @@ -3,10 +3,10 @@
System Information
========================================================================

generated by SchemaCrawler 16.19.7
generated on 2023-03-01 00:33:59
database version H2 2.1.214 (2022-06-13)
driver version H2 JDBC Driver 2.1.214 (2022-06-13)
generated by SchemaCrawler 16.20.2
generated on 2023-07-08 21:07:08
database version H2 2.2.220 (2023-07-04)
driver version H2 JDBC Driver 2.2.220 (2023-07-04)



Expand Down Expand Up @@ -344,7 +344,7 @@ ARRAY [data type]
BIGINT [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

BINARY [data type]
Expand Down Expand Up @@ -398,13 +398,13 @@ DATE [data type]
DECFLOAT [data type]
defined with PRECISION
nullable
not auto-incrementable
auto-incrementable
searchable

DOUBLE PRECISION [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

ENUM [data type]
Expand All @@ -422,7 +422,7 @@ GEOMETRY [data type]
INTEGER [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

INTERVAL DAY [data type]
Expand Down Expand Up @@ -518,13 +518,13 @@ JSON [data type]
NUMERIC [data type]
defined with PRECISION,SCALE
nullable
not auto-incrementable
auto-incrementable
searchable

REAL [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

ROW [data type]
Expand All @@ -536,7 +536,7 @@ ROW [data type]
SMALLINT [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

TIME [data type]
Expand Down Expand Up @@ -566,7 +566,7 @@ TIME WITH TIME ZONE [data type]
TINYINT [data type]
defined with no parameters
nullable
not auto-incrementable
auto-incrementable
searchable

UUID [data type]
Expand Down Expand Up @@ -604,7 +604,7 @@ System Information
Database Information
-=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=-
database product name H2
database product version 2.1.214 (2022-06-13)
database product version 2.2.220 (2023-07-04)
database user name


Expand All @@ -620,14 +620,14 @@ client info properties numServers
data definition causes transaction commit true
data definition ignored in transactions false
database major version 2
database minor version 1
database minor version 2
default transaction isolation 2
deletes are detected for TYPE_FORWARD_ONLY result sets false
deletes are detected for TYPE_SCROLL_INSENSITIVE result sets false
deletes are detected for TYPE_SCROLL_SENSITIVE result sets false
does max row size include blobs false
driver major version 2
driver minor version 1
driver minor version 2
extra name characters
generated key always returned true
identifier quote string "
Expand Down Expand Up @@ -698,7 +698,7 @@ stores mixed case identifiers false
stores mixed case quoted identifiers false
stores upper case identifiers true
stores upper case quoted identifiers false
string functions ASCII, BIT_LENGTH, CHAR_LENGTH, OCTET_LENGTH, CHAR, CONCAT, CONCAT_WS, DIFFERENCE, HEXTORAW, RAWTOHEX, INSERT, LOWER, UPPER, LEFT, RIGHT, LOCATE, LPAD, RPAD, LTRIM, RTRIM, TRIM, REGEXP_REPLACE, REGEXP_LIKE, REGEXP_SUBSTR, REPEAT, REPLACE, SOUNDEX, SPACE, STRINGDECODE, STRINGENCODE, STRINGTOUTF8, SUBSTRING, UTF8TOSTRING, QUOTE_IDENT, XMLATTR, XMLNODE, XMLCOMMENT, XMLCDATA, XMLSTARTDOC, XMLTEXT, TO_CHAR, TRANSLATE
string functions ASCII, BIT_LENGTH, CHAR_LENGTH, OCTET_LENGTH, CHAR, CONCAT, CONCAT_WS, DIFFERENCE, HEXTORAW, RAWTOHEX, INSERT, LOWER, UPPER, LEFT, RIGHT, LOCATE, LPAD, RPAD, LTRIM, RTRIM, BTRIM, TRIM, REGEXP_REPLACE, REGEXP_LIKE, REGEXP_SUBSTR, REPEAT, REPLACE, SOUNDEX, SPACE, STRINGDECODE, STRINGENCODE, STRINGTOUTF8, SUBSTRING, UTF8TOSTRING, QUOTE_IDENT, XMLATTR, XMLNODE, XMLCOMMENT, XMLCDATA, XMLSTARTDOC, XMLTEXT, TO_CHAR, TRANSLATE
supports alter table with add column true
supports alter table with drop column true
supports ANSI92 entry level SQL true
Expand Down Expand Up @@ -768,7 +768,7 @@ supports union true
supports union all true
system functions ABORT_SESSION, ARRAY_GET, CARDINALITY, ARRAY_CONTAINS, ARRAY_CAT, ARRAY_APPEND, ARRAY_MAX_CARDINALITY, TRIM_ARRAY, ARRAY_SLICE, AUTOCOMMIT, CANCEL_SESSION, CASEWHEN, COALESCE, CONVERT, CURRVAL, CSVWRITE, CURRENT_SCHEMA, CURRENT_CATALOG, DATABASE_PATH, DATA_TYPE_SQL, DB_OBJECT_ID, DB_OBJECT_SQL, DECODE, DISK_SPACE_USED, SIGNAL, ESTIMATED_ENVELOPE, FILE_READ, FILE_WRITE, GREATEST, LEAST, LOCK_MODE, LOCK_TIMEOUT, MEMORY_FREE, MEMORY_USED, NEXTVAL, NULLIF, NVL2, READONLY, ROWNUM, SESSION_ID, SET, TRANSACTION_ID, TRUNCATE_VALUE, CURRENT_PATH, CURRENT_ROLE, CURRENT_USER, H2VERSION
table types BASE TABLE, GLOBAL TEMPORARY, LOCAL TEMPORARY, SYNONYM, VIEW
time date functions CURRENT_DATE, CURRENT_TIME, CURRENT_TIMESTAMP, LOCALTIME, LOCALTIMESTAMP, DATEADD, DATEDIFF, DATE_TRUNC, DAYNAME, DAY_OF_MONTH, DAY_OF_WEEK, ISO_DAY_OF_WEEK, DAY_OF_YEAR, EXTRACT, FORMATDATETIME, HOUR, MINUTE, MONTH, MONTHNAME, PARSEDATETIME, QUARTER, SECOND, WEEK, ISO_WEEK, YEAR, ISO_YEAR
time date functions CURRENT_DATE, CURRENT_TIME, CURRENT_TIMESTAMP, LOCALTIME, LOCALTIMESTAMP, DATEADD, DATEDIFF, DATE_TRUNC, LAST_DAY, DAYNAME, DAY_OF_MONTH, DAY_OF_WEEK, ISO_DAY_OF_WEEK, DAY_OF_YEAR, EXTRACT, FORMATDATETIME, HOUR, MINUTE, MONTH, MONTHNAME, PARSEDATETIME, QUARTER, SECOND, WEEK, ISO_WEEK, YEAR, ISO_YEAR
type info ARRAY, BIGINT, BINARY, BINARY LARGE OBJECT, BINARY VARYING, BOOLEAN, CHARACTER, CHARACTER LARGE OBJECT, CHARACTER VARYING, DATE, DECFLOAT, DOUBLE PRECISION, ENUM, GEOMETRY, INTEGER, INTERVAL DAY, INTERVAL DAY TO HOUR, INTERVAL DAY TO MINUTE, INTERVAL DAY TO SECOND, INTERVAL HOUR, INTERVAL HOUR TO MINUTE, INTERVAL HOUR TO SECOND, INTERVAL MINUTE, INTERVAL MINUTE TO SECOND, INTERVAL MONTH, INTERVAL SECOND, INTERVAL YEAR, INTERVAL YEAR TO MONTH, JAVA_OBJECT, JSON, NUMERIC, REAL, ROW, SMALLINT, TIME, TIME WITH TIME ZONE, TIMESTAMP, TIMESTAMP WITH TIME ZONE, TINYINT, UUID, VARCHAR_IGNORECASE
updates are detected for TYPE_FORWARD_ONLY result sets false
updates are detected for TYPE_SCROLL_INSENSITIVE result sets false
Expand All @@ -781,7 +781,7 @@ JDBC Driver Information
-=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=--=-
connection url jdbc:h2:mem:schemacrawler
driver name H2 JDBC Driver
driver version 2.1.214 (2022-06-13)
driver version 2.2.220 (2023-07-04)
driver class name org.h2.Driver
is JDBC compliant true
supported JDBC version 4.2
Expand Down

0 comments on commit d8baf1a

Please sign in to comment.